    <title>2024 (7) TMI 131 - ITAT AHMEDABAD</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=754911</link>
    <description>ITAT Ahmedabad allowed the assessee&#039;s appeal against CIT&#039;s revision order u/s 263. The assessee, a government-funded organization for philanthropic purposes, incorrectly claimed exemption u/s 10(23C)(iiiae) instead of the correct provision 10(23C)(iiiac). During revision proceedings, the assessee argued eligibility for exemption u/s 10(23C)(iiiac) and section 11. ITAT held that CIT failed to consider alternate claims and supporting documents before setting aside the assessment order. The tribunal found no prejudice to revenue since the assessee was eligible for exemption under correct provisions despite the inadvertent error.</description>
